Zac Brown Band says Vancouver show canceled after team members turned away at border


VANCOUVER — The Zac Brown Band has issued an apology for canceling its show in Vancouver, saying some members of the band were turned away at the border.

The band released a statement on Facebook hours before a Friday night performance at Rogers Arena as part of their Out In the Middle tour.

Brown says some members of the team had charges from more than a decade ago removed from their records and entered Canada regularly during that time, including for just two shows this year.

He says that each time, the band members were at the mercy of a single border agent who decided who could enter the country.

Brown says the group is a family that pulls together to support each other and would never leave anyone behind.

Rogers Arena says on its website that spectators will be reimbursed for tickets that go on sale starting in January.
